Overview
Citizens can now choose a self service option to initiate service requests using the same workflow logic available to your departments.

Service request types are easy to identify either through pull down menus or keyword searches. Locations can be validated and questions appropriate to the service request type asked. Your citizens can provide the details needed to properly engage your departments to response.

Once service requests are submitted, your citizens receive a confirmation email and can follow up on the status of their requests.

Other searches to expedite answers to your citizens questionsare are also available. Searching your knowledge base, citizens can quickly find information without having to call, reducing the burden on your call agents or front office personal.

Fully leveraging your agencies GIS, CSR can provide specific information to citizens, based on topics relevant to their residence or locations of interest.

  • Object Proximity Searches: Often the service request is one where the information can easily be handled over the web. "Where can I" questions, such as the nearest place to get flu shots, pay my water bill or borrow a library book are such types of requests.
  • Directory Searches: Another frequent set of questions is "Who are" types. Who is my council person and how do I contact them? Citizens can search for appropriate departments from pull down lists and drill down to subgroups and individuals as needed, with phone numbers, street addresses and email addresses.
